Trailer Watch: Natalie Portman Tries to Save Her Husband’s Life in “Annihilation”

“Annihilation”

“Start from the beginning,” Natalie Portman is told in a new trailer for “Annihilation.” We’re transported to the not-so-distant past, and see the Oscar winner’s character, a biologist, hanging out with her husband (Oscar Isaac, “Star Wars: The Force Awakens”). He then embarks on a mysterious expedition, and when he comes home, he’s extremely ill.

“If I knew what happened, I could save his life,” the biologist insists. So she decides to volunteer for the same expedition he did, and heads to a mysterious, abandoned, and altogether otherworldly-looking location known as Area X. She and three other women compose the 12th expedition: a surveyor (Tessa Thompson, “Thor: Ragnarok”), psychologist (Jennifer Jason Leigh, “Twin Peaks”), and paramedic (Gina Rodriguez, “Jane the Virgin”).

The trailer includes footage of Area X, where we’re told life is in “continuous mutation” and the women face terrifying predators. We also learn a little bit about the fate of the soldiers on the last expedition — and it doesn’t bode well for this foursome.

The sci-fi film is based on Jeff VanderMeer’s novel of the same name, which is part of a series, so “Annihilation” has franchise potential. The pic is written and directed by Alex Garland (“Ex Machina”) and hits theaters February 23, 2018.
